Curriculum Highlights

Core subjects include English language, mathematics, computing, personal and social development, science, humanities, art and physical education (PE); all non-PE subjects are accredited at a level up to GCSE. Careers pathways include creative craft, food and cookery, sport, interactive media, and music technology. Younger pupils are taught by two qualified teachers in a 'team teacher' model. Small classes of around four to eight pupils. Assemblies and extra-curricular clubs are provided at the end of the school day, and regular educational trips enhance the curriculum.
